The Emergence of the Digital Nomad Way of Life
With the expansion of remote work opportunities, the digital nomad lifestyle has become increasingly popular among professionals pursuing flexibility and adventure. This lifestyle, characterized by the ability to work from any location, allows individuals to travel while maintaining their careers. Many are attracted to the allure of exploring new cultures and environments, often in picturesque settings that encourage creativity and productivity.
Over recent years, technology improvements have supported this shift, permitting uninterrupted communication and collaboration irrespective of geographical borders. The expansion of coworking spaces and online platforms further reinforces this trend, delivering essential resources for remote workers.
As a result, a wide-ranging community of digital nomads has developed, sharing experiences and insights for managing this exceptional way of life. The expanding acceptance of remote work by companies worldwide has cemented the digital nomad lifestyle as a viable career path, drawing in those who emphasize both personal and professional growth.

Overcoming Challenges of Remote Work
Though remote work delivers flexibility and independence, it also creates unique challenges that can impede productivity and well-being. Many remote workers struggle with feelings of isolation, as the lack of in-person interactions can cause a disconnect from colleagues and a reduced sense of community. Moreover, the blurred boundaries between work and personal life can contribute to overworking, consequently influencing mental health and job satisfaction.
Time management emerges as critical, as distractions at home—such as household chores and family commitments—can hamper focus. Furthermore, access to consistent technology is vital; connectivity issues or poor tools can frustrate workers and delay progress.
